The European Climate Foundation (ECF) was founded in 2008 as a major philanthropic initiative to help tackle climate change by fostering the development of a low-carbon society at the national, European and global level.
We support over 350 partner organisations to carry out activities that contribute to the public debate on climate action, drive urgent and ambitious policy in support of the objectives of the Paris Agreement and help deliver a socially responsible transition to a net-zero emissions economy and sustainable society in Europe and around the world.

About the role
The ECF’s strategic communications team is the outreach unit of the foundation. Its role is to act as a centre of expertise for communication on climate change and to play an active role in helping create more political, media and public endorsement for action on climate change at an international, national and sectoral level. Team members deliver strategic advice, communications and outreach support to ECF’s programmes and its grantees, and work as part of a global network of communications experts to enhance the public debate on climate change and its solutions.
As Senior HR / Organisational Design Partner, Strategic Communications you will join a vibrant and growing international team preparing to transition to a new operating structure. In this context, you will lead the development of a new human resource strategy and infrastructure, supporting the new structure’s objectives and in line with the team’s strategy and values. This will include a framework for compensation and benefits, contracting, performance management, learning and development, and HR Information Systems to support the administrative management and to help attract, develop and retain diverse talent based in countries around the globe.
This new role is an exciting opportunity for a strategic and flexible HR professional with competencies in change management and organisational design. You will be a key part of a dedicated project team, contributing your strategic HR know-how to a mission-driven, internationally operating team.
You will collaborate closely with the Human Resources team handling the day-to-day HR management, the wider Project and Operations Team including IT and Legal, and the Management Team, as well as external stakeholders and service providers.
The Senior HR / Organisational Design Partner, Strategic Communications will report to the Senior Project Manager, Strategic Communications.
